将包含动态数据的json字符串作为源传递给primeNG数据化。

问题描述 投票:0回答:1

我将从服务中动态获取json,如下所示。

{"items":[[{"key": "SerialID","value": "P1.M1.T1"},{  "key": "Description",  "value": "Dummy Desc 1"},{  "key": "Label",  "value": "A123"}],[{"key": "SerialID","value": "P1.M1.T2"},{  "key": "Description",  "value": "Dummy Desc 2"},{  "key": "Label",  "value": "B123"}]]}

这里,给出了项目数组中的2行示例。我将得到多条这样的行。另外,每行的列数可能会非常多(例如,每行的列数为3列)。这里,我收到的是每行3列。我可能会收到n个数字。然而,在输入的所有行中,它将是相同的)。)

我想把这个json作为数据源传递给primeNG表,并以表格格式呈现。所以列和行都需要动态生成。我试着解析json,但不知为何无法为primeNG表形成合适的输入。

任何帮助都是非常感激的。

json loops angular7 primeng primeng-datatable
1个回答
0
投票

我终于迭代了我的JSON,以PrimeNG期望的格式形成了列和行数组,并将其传递给了组件。它成功了

© www.soinside.com 2019 - 2024. All rights reserved.